+/*
+ *
+ * Watchdog Timer Configuration
+ *
+ * The function of the watchdog timer is to reset the system
+ * automatically and is defined at I/O port 0443H.  To enable the
+ * watchdog timer and allow the system to reset, write I/O port 0443H.
+ * To disable the timer, write I/O port 0441H for the system to stop the
+ * watchdog function.  The timer has a tolerance of 20% for its
+ * intervals.
+ *
+ * The following describes how the timer should be programmed.
+ *
+ * Enabling Watchdog:
+ * MOV AX,000FH (Choose the values from 0 to F)
+ * MOV DX,0443H
+ * OUT DX,AX
+ *
+ * Disabling Watchdog:
+ * MOV AX,000FH (Any value is fine.)
+ * MOV DX,0441H
+ * OUT DX,AX
+ *
+ * Watchdog timer control table:
+ * Level   Value  Time/sec | Level Value Time/sec
+ *   1       F       0     |   9     7      16
+ *   2       E       2     |   10    6      18
+ *   3       D       4     |   11    5      20
+ *   4       C       6     |   12    4      22
+ *   5       B       8     |   13    3      24
+ *   6       A       10    |   14    2      26
+ *   7       9       12    |   15    1      28
+ *   8       8       14    |   16    0      30
+ *
+ */
+
+#define WDT_STOP 0x441
+#define WDT_START 0x443
+
+#define WD_TIMO 0      /* 30 seconds +/- 20%, from table */

+/*
+ *   Kernel methods.
+ */
+
+static void
+ibwdt_ping(void)
+{
+   /* Write a watchdog value */
+   outb_p(WD_TIMO, WDT_START);
+}
+
+static ssize_t
+ibwdt_write(struct file *file, const char *buf, size_t count, loff_t *ppos)
+{
+   /*  Can't seek (pwrite) on this device  */
+   if (ppos != &file->f_pos)
+      return -ESPIPE;
+
+   if (count) {
+      ibwdt_ping();
+      return 1;
+   }
+   return 0;
+}
+
+static ssize_t
+ibwdt_read(struct file *file, char *buf, size_t count, loff_t *ppos)
+{
+   return -EINVAL;
+}
+
+static int
+ibwdt_ioctl(struct inode *inode, struct file *file, unsigned int cmd,
+     unsigned long arg)
+{
+   static struct watchdog_info ident = {
+      WDIOF_KEEPALIVEPING, 1, "IB700 WDT"
+   };
+
+   switch (cmd) {
+   case WDIOC_GETSUPPORT:
+     if (copy_to_user((struct watchdog_info *)arg, &ident, sizeof(ident)))
+       return -EFAULT;
+     break;
+
+   case WDIOC_GETSTATUS:
+     if (copy_to_user((int *)arg, &ibwdt_is_open,  sizeof(int)))
+       return -EFAULT;
+     break;
+
+   case WDIOC_KEEPALIVE:
+     ibwdt_ping();
+     break;
+
+   default:
+     return -ENOTTY;
+   }
+   return 0;
+}
+
+static int
+ibwdt_open(struct inode *inode, struct file *file)
+{
+   switch (MINOR(inode->i_rdev)) {
+      case WATCHDOG_MINOR:
+         spin_lock(&ibwdt_lock);
+         if (ibwdt_is_open) {
+            spin_unlock(&ibwdt_lock);
+            return -EBUSY;
+         }
+         /*
+          *   Activate
+          */
+
+         ibwdt_is_open = 1;
+         ibwdt_ping();
+         spin_unlock(&ibwdt_lock);
+         return 0;
+      default:
+         return -ENODEV;
+   }
+}
+
+static int
+ibwdt_close(struct inode *inode, struct file *file)
+{
+   lock_kernel();
+   if (MINOR(inode->i_rdev) == WATCHDOG_MINOR) {
+      spin_lock(&ibwdt_lock);
+#ifndef CONFIG_WATCHDOG_NOWAYOUT
+      outb_p(WD_TIMO, WDT_STOP);
+#endif
+      ibwdt_is_open = 0;
+      spin_unlock(&ibwdt_lock);
+   }
+   unlock_kernel();
+   return 0;
+}
+
+/*
+ *   Notifier for system down
+ */
+
+static int
+ibwdt_notify_sys(struct notifier_block *this, unsigned long code,
+   void *unused)
+{
+   if (code == SYS_DOWN || code == SYS_HALT) {
+      /* Turn the WDT off */
+      outb_p(WD_TIMO, WDT_STOP);
+   }
+   return NOTIFY_DONE;
+}
+
+/*
+ *   Kernel Interfaces
+ */
+
+static struct file_operations ibwdt_fops = {
+   owner:      THIS_MODULE,
+   read:      ibwdt_read,
+   write:      ibwdt_write,
+   ioctl:      ibwdt_ioctl,
+   open:      ibwdt_open,
+   release:   ibwdt_close,
+};
+
+static struct miscdevice ibwdt_miscdev = {
+   WATCHDOG_MINOR,
+   "watchdog",
+   &ibwdt_fops
+};
+
+/*
+ *   The WDT needs to learn about soft shutdowns in order to
+ *   turn the timebomb registers off.
+ */
+
+static struct notifier_block ibwdt_notifier = {
+   ibwdt_notify_sys,
+   NULL,
+   0
+};
+
+static int __init
+ibwdt_init(void)
+{
+   printk("WDT driver for IB700 single board computer initialising.\n");
+
+   spin_lock_init(&ibwdt_lock);
+   misc_register(&ibwdt_miscdev);
+#if WDT_START != WDT_STOP
+   request_region(WDT_STOP, 1, "IB700 WDT");
+#endif
+   request_region(WDT_START, 1, "IB700 WDT");
+   register_reboot_notifier(&ibwdt_notifier);
+   return 0;
+}
+
+static void __exit
+ibwdt_exit(void)
+{
+   misc_deregister(&ibwdt_miscdev);
+   unregister_reboot_notifier(&ibwdt_notifier);
+#if WDT_START != WDT_STOP
+   release_region(WDT_STOP,1);
+#endif
+   release_region(WDT_START,1);
+}
+
+module_init(ibwdt_init);
+module_exit(ibwdt_exit);
+
+MODULE_AUTHOR("Charles Howes <chowes@vsol.net>");
+MODULE_DESCRIPTION("IB700 SBC watchdog driver");
+MODULE_LICENSE("GPL");
+
+/* end of ib700wdt.c */
